Segmantation:

In terms of EV, the BEV (Battery Electric Vehicles) segment is anticipated to account for the greatest market share for Automotive Torque Vectoring throughout the forecast period. On the other hand, electric vehicle architectures with individual wheel propulsion systems provide selective torque distribution. Torque vectoring offers an effective way to increase the operating range of an electric car in addition to improving vehicle control and safety.
The automotive torque vectoring market has a growth opportunity due to future vehicle technology linked to yaw moment management, anti-lock braking, and traction control through the use of efficient torque vectoring systems for electric vehicles.
